DeepCodex零门槛指南:Codex与DeepSeek无缝对接

2026-06-12阅读 0热度 0
DeepSeek

在编程领域,AI编程助手如今已经是开发者提升效率、排查代码问题、学习新语言的标配工具。Codex桌面端凭借其出色的代码理解、生成与调试能力,赢得了大批开发者的青睐。不过,不少人在用得顺手之后,都会冒出同一个念头:要是能把Codex默认的底层模型,换成自己平时用得最顺手的DeepSeek,那该多好。

问题在于,这两者的接口协议完全不同。普通用户要想手动完成协议适配、接口配置、模型切换这一整套操作,不仅步骤多得让人头疼,还特别容易因为某个参数配错导致调用失败。对于刚入门的新手来说,这几乎是个不可能完成的任务。

为了解决这个痛点,DeepCodex 应运而生。它通过在本地搭建一个轻量级的桥接服务,自动完成两大模型之间的协议转换,同时提供了可视化的命令行菜单,实现一键切换模型。说白了,就是填个密钥就能开箱即用。本文将从技术原理、前期准备、分步部署、功能测试、常见问题排查等多个维度,配合实际操作命令和界面讲解,完整介绍DeepCodex的使用方法,帮助不同技术水平的用户快速完成Codex与DeepSeek的联动配置。

一、技术背景与核心原理:为什么需要DeepCodex桥接服务

想要理解DeepCodex的价值,首先要弄清楚Codex与DeepSeek在接口协议上的核心差异——这也是二者无法直接互通的根本原因。

Codex桌面端深度适配的是OpenAI Responses API 协议。这个协议主打智能体场景,具备服务端会话状态保存、多模态输入、链式调用等能力,是面向复杂智能交互设计的新一代接口规范。而DeepSeek对外提供的标准接口则是Chat Completions API,这是目前行业内普及度最高的对话接口,采用无状态设计,依靠客户端传递消息上下文来实现连续对话。两者的数据请求格式、字段定义、响应结构完全不兼容。

如果不借助中转工具,直接把DeepSeek的接口地址填到Codex配置里,结果就是请求报错、模型无响应、参数解析失败,一连串的问题等着你。传统的解决方案需要开发者手动编写袋里脚本,先解析Codex发出的Responses API请求,转换成Chat Completions API格式转发给DeepSeek,再把DeepSeek的响应逆向转换回Responses API格式返回给Codex。整个过程涉及网络请求、数据格式化、异常捕获等代码编写,门槛高得离谱。

DeepCodex的核心定位就是一个轻量级的本地Bridge(桥接服务)。它的工作流程非常清晰:本地启动后台服务后,监听指定端口的网络请求,接收来自Codex的请求数据,自动完成Responses API到Chat Completions API的协议转译,调用DeepSeek官方接口获取返回结果,最后再将结果反向适配为Responses API格式回传给Codex。整个协议转换过程完全自动化,用户不需要编写任何代码,也不用修改什么复杂的配置文件。

同时,DeepCodex内置了模型列表适配逻辑,能够让Codex正常识别DeepSeek V4 Flash、DeepSeek V4 Pro等主流模型。再加上交互式命令行菜单,密钥配置、模型切换、配置还原等操作都能一键完成。

这个项目是开源的,所有代码和安装包都公开托管在代码仓库里,版本更新、问题反馈、官方说明都能随时查看。开源地址是 miloce/DeepCodex,后续使用中遇到版本兼容、功能异常等问题,都可以优先去那里找找解决方案。

二、前期准备工作:安装Codex桌面端

在部署DeepCodex之前,必须先完成Codex桌面端的安装,这是整个联动方案的基础。Codex提供Windows、macOS两大主流系统的桌面版本,适配绝大多数个人电脑,具体安装步骤如下:

  • 打开Codex官方网站,根据自身操作系统选择对应的安装包:Windows系统点击页面内的“下载Windows版”按钮,macOS系统选择对应的macOS下载入口;
  • 等待安装包下载完成,双击安装程序,按照系统引导完成默认安装,全程不需要额外配置;
  • 安装完成后启动Codex桌面端,确认软件可以正常打开、进入主界面。暂时不需要登录和进行模型设置,关闭软件等待后续配置。

整个安装流程和常规桌面软件一样,全程可视化操作,零基础的用户也可以顺利完成。需要注意的是,尽量选择官方最新稳定版本,这样可以降低后续模型适配过程中间出现版本兼容问题的概率。

三、第一步:申请并获取DeepSeek API Key

DeepSeek接口调用需要通过专属的API Key来完成身份鉴权,这是调用接口的核心凭证,也是DeepCodex运行的必要参数。该密钥以sk-开头,仅在创建时可见,所以一定要妥善保存。具体获取流程如下:

  • 打开DeepSeek开放平台官网,使用个人账号完成登录。未注册的用户需要先完成账号注册与实名认证;
  • 登录成功后,在平台导航栏中找到API keys管理页面,进入密钥管理界面;
  • 点击页面中的“创建API key”按钮,根据提示填写密钥名称(自定义即可,用于区分不同使用场景),确认创建;
  • 密钥生成后,页面会展示完整的密钥字符串,立即复制并单独保存。平台有规则限制,密钥仅在创建时可完整查看,关闭页面后无法再次查看原始密钥。如果不小心丢失,只能重新创建。

重要使用规范:DeepSeek API Key相当于账号的访问凭证,严禁将密钥分享给他人,也不要直接写入前端代码或公开配置文件中,避免密钥泄露导致账号被恶意调用、产生不必要的费用。一旦发现密钥异常使用,可以在 API keys 管理页面中及时禁用。

四、第二步:下载并运行DeepCodex本地程序

拿到API Key之后,就可以正式开始部署DeepCodex桥接服务了。这个软件提供了Windows、macOS、Linux全平台的安装包,不需要复杂编译,下载解压后就能直接运行。详细操作步骤搭配实操命令如下:

  • 打开DeepCodex的Releases版本发布页面,页面里会展示所有正式发布的安装包,选择适配自己系统的压缩包:
    • Windows系统:选择 deepcodex-app-windows.zip
    • macOS系统:选择 deepcodex-app-macos.zip
    • Linux系统:选择 deepcodex-app-linux.zip
  • 把压缩包下载到本地任意目录,用解压工具完成解压。解压后的文件夹里包含程序主体文件,没有额外的依赖组件;
  • 根据操作系统运行程序:
    • Windows系统:直接双击文件夹内的 deepcodex.exe 可执行文件,程序会唤起命令行窗口并启动;
    • macOS / Linux系统:打开终端工具,通过 cd 命令切换到解压后的文件目录,执行启动命令:
      # 切换至DeepCodex解压目录,请替换为你的实际文件路径
      cd /Users/xxx/Desktop/deepcodex-app-macos
      # 启动DeepCodex程序
      ./deepcodex

程序启动成功后,会弹出命令行交互界面。此时需要保持这个窗口全程开启,一旦关闭,本地桥接服务就会立即停止,Codex也就无法继续调用DeepSeek模型了。

五、第三步:配置密钥并切换至DeepSeek模型

DeepCodex启动后会进入交互式配置流程,全程根据命令行提示操作即可,完全不需要修改配置文件。这也是这个工具对新手最友好的地方。分步操作流程如下:

  • 首次运行DeepCodex时,命令行会出现 DeepSeek API Key: 输入提示。把你之前复制的sk-开头密钥完整粘贴到输入框里,按下回车键完成密钥保存。程序会自动校验密钥格式,格式错误时会给出提示,重新粘贴就可以了;
  • 密钥保存成功后,程序会进入功能选择菜单,菜单选项如下:
    当前状态 Key Codex:原配置 -Bridge:未运行
    1.使用DeepSeek
    2.使用原配置
    3.修改Deep Seek API Key
    4.退出
    请选择:
  • 在输入框中输入数字 1,按下回车,选择“使用DeepSeek”选项。程序会自动启动本地Bridge桥接服务,同时自动修改Codex的后台配置,适配接口地址与模型列表;
  • 配置成功后,命令行会输出桥接服务地址与当前生效模型,示例如下:
    正在获取DeepSeek模型... 已切到DeepSeek: deepseek-v4-flash
    Bridge地址:http://127.0.0.1:1314/v1 按回车继续...

    这个地址是本地回环地址,只有本机可以访问,不需要手动记录和修改,按下回车键回到主菜单就可以了。

菜单功能补充说明

  • 选项2.使用原配置:一键还原Codex默认配置,停止DeepSeek桥接服务,切换回Codex原始模型;
  • 选项3.修改Deep Seek API Key:当密钥过期、更换账号、密钥泄露时,可以重新录入新的密钥;
  • 选项4.退出:关闭DeepCodex程序,终止本地桥接服务。

六、第四步:重启Codex并完成功能测试

DeepCodex的配置只修改了后台接口参数,正在运行的Codex是无法自动加载新配置的。所以必须重启Codex客户端,才能完成整个模型切换流程。具体测试步骤如下:

  • 彻底关闭Codex桌面端(建议在任务管理器中确认进程完全退出,避免后台残留进程影响配置加载),然后重新双击图标启动Codex;
  • 等待Codex加载完成,进入主界面后,开始发起测试请求。这里以Python代码生成为例,在输入框中输入测试指令:
    帮我写一个 Python 冒泡排序函数
  • 发送指令后,观察两大核心状态,判断配置是否生效:
    • 功能状态:Codex能够正常输出完整的代码内容、代码注释与逻辑说明,没有超时、报错、空白回复等问题;
    • 模型状态:查看Codex顶部的模型选择菜单,菜单里会显示 DeepSeek V4 Flash 或 DeepSeek V4 Pro,这代表当前已经成功切换至DeepSeek系列模型。

如果以上两项都正常,说明DeepCodex桥接服务、协议转换、模型适配全部生效。此后你就可以正常使用Codex客户端调用DeepSeek大模型进行编程工作了。日常使用时,只需要先启动DeepCodex并保持命令行窗口常开,再打开Codex就可以了,不需要重复配置密钥和模型。

七、进阶补充:手动校验配置与基础运维命令

对于有一定基础的开发者来说,可以通过命令行和配置文件来校验Codex的接口配置状态,同时掌握一些基础运维操作,方便排查一些隐性问题。下面提供跨平台查看配置、端口检测的实操命令。

1. 查看Codex本地配置文件

Codex会将接口地址、模型供应商等配置写入本地配置文件,可以通过命令查看当前接口指向,确认是否对接上了本地Bridge服务:

  • Windows系统(PowerShell终端)
    # 查看Codex主配置文件
    Get-Content "$HOME\.codex\config.toml"
  • macOS / Linux系统(终端)
    # 查看Codex主配置文件
    cat ~/.codex/config.toml

正常配置下,文件内的base_url字段会指向DeepCodex本地桥接地址 http://127.0.0.1:1314/v1wire_api字段为responses,说明协议已经正常适配。

2. 检测本地桥接端口占用

DeepCodex默认占用 1314 端口,如果这个端口被其他程序占用了,服务就会启动失败。可以通过端口检测命令来排查:

  • Windows系统(CMD终端)
    # 检测1314端口占用情况
    netstat -ano | findstr "1314"
  • macOS / Linux系统(终端)
    # 检测1314端口占用情况
    lsof -i :1314

如果命令返回了进程信息,说明端口正常在监听;如果没有返回任何内容,就代表桥接服务没启动或者发生了端口冲突。

3. 日常启停运维流程

  • 日常使用启动顺序:启动DeepCodex(保持窗口打开)→ 启动Codex;
  • 切换回原模型:打开DeepCodex菜单,输入 2 还原配置 → 重启Codex;
  • 彻底停止服务:关闭Codex → 关闭DeepCodex命令行窗口。

八、常见问题排查与解决方案

在部署和使用过程中,有些用户会遇到各种各样的报错问题。结合协议特性和软件运行逻辑,这里整理了高频故障场景和对应的解决办法,覆盖了密钥、网络、端口、模型识别这四大类问题。

  • 问题一:提示 Invalid API Key(密钥无效)
    原因:密钥粘贴时带了多余的空格、密钥输入错误、密钥已过期,或者账号余额不足。
    解决:进入DeepCodex菜单选择 3.修改Deep Seek API Key,重新复制粘贴密钥(粘贴前清空输入框);登录DeepSeek开放平台,查看密钥状态与账号余额,过期的密钥直接重新创建。
  • 问题二:Codex发送请求后无响应、请求超时
    原因:DeepCodex命令行窗口被关闭了、本地端口被防火墙拦截了、网络无法访问DeepSeek官方接口。
    解决:确认DeepCodex持续在运行;临时关闭系统防火墙,或者放行 1314 端口;检查本地网络,确保可以正常访问DeepSeek的接口地址。
  • 问题三:模型菜单依旧显示原模型名称,但请求可正常使用
    原因:新版的Codex采用了动态拉取模型列表的机制,部分袋里适配暂时还没有完全兼容。
    解决:这种情况属于界面显示问题,模型实际上已经切换成了DeepSeek,不影响正常使用。如果想把显示问题也修复了,可以关注DeepCodex开源仓库的版本更新,等待开发者适配新版Codex。
  • 问题四:启动DeepCodex提示端口冲突
    原因:1314 端口被浏览器、袋里工具、或者其他后台程序占用了。
    解决:通过上面提到的端口检测命令找到占用进程,结束对应的程序,然后重新启动DeepCodex。

九、总结

DeepCodex的出现,很好地解决了Codex与DeepSeek因接口协议不兼容而导致的模型切换难题。它摒弃了传统那种需要手动编写袋里脚本、逐行修改配置文件的复杂方式,以本地轻量桥接服务为核心,自动完成OpenAI Responses API与Chat Completions API之间的双向协议转换。加上可视化命令行菜单,模型切换、密钥管理、配置还原这些操作被简化成了简单的点选,真正做到了“小白开箱即用”。

从技术架构来看,整个方案分为三层:最上层是Codex桌面端,作为面向用户的交互入口;中间层是DeepCodex本地Bridge服务,承担协议转换、请求转发、模型适配的核心作用;最下层是DeepSeek大模型接口,提供代码生成、逻辑推理等AI能力。三层架构分工明确,部署简单,运行稳定,而且全程基于本地转发,不会把数据上传到第三方服务器,保障了代码内容和对话数据的安全性。

对于普通开发者来说,借助这套方案,你可以自由地结合Codex流畅的客户端体验与DeepSeek强大的代码推理能力,完全不用关心底层的协议差异,把精力都放在编码工作上。对于技术爱好者来说,DeepCodex的开源设计也为学习API协议转换、本地袋里服务开发提供了一个不错的实践案例。整套部署流程适配Windows、macOS、Linux三大主流系统,步骤标准化,只要按照本文的分步指引操作,就能快速完成配置,让两大主流AI编程工具高效地联动起来。

免责声明

本网站新闻资讯均来自公开渠道,力求准确但不保证绝对无误,内容观点仅代表作者本人,与本站无关。若涉及侵权,请联系我们处理。本站保留对声明的修改权,最终解释权归本站所有。

相关阅读

更多
欢迎回来 登录或注册后,可保存提示词和历史记录
登录后可同步收藏、历史记录和常用模板
注册即表示同意服务条款与隐私政策